Full Description

Principles of Modern Radar: Basic Principles is a comprehensive and modern textbook for courses in radar systems and technology at the college senior and graduate student level; a professional training textbook for formal in-house courses for new hires; a reference for ongoing study following a radar short course; and a self-study and professional reference book.

Principles of Modern Radar focuses on four key areas:



Basic concepts, such as the the radar range equation and threshold detection
Radar signal phenomenology, such as radar cross section models, clutter, atmospheric effects, and Doppler effects
Descriptions of all major subsystems of modern radars, such as the antenna, transmitter, receiver, including modern architectural elements such as exciters, and advanced signal processors
Signal and data processing basics, from digital signal processing (DSP) fundamentals, through detection, Doppler processing, waveforms and pulse compression, basic imaging concepts, and tracking fundamentals.

While several established books address introductory radar systems, Principles of Modern Radar differs from these in its breadth of coverage, its emphasis on current methods (without losing sight of bedrock principles), and its adoption of an appropriate level of quantitative rigor for the intended audience of students and new professional hires.

Contents

Part I: Overview
Chapter 1: Introduction and Radar Overview
Chapter 2: The Radar Range Equation
Chapter 3: Radar Search and Overview of Detection in Interference
Part II: External Factors
Chapter 4: Propagation Effects and Mechanisms
Chapter 5: Characteristics of Clutter
Chapter 6: Target Reflectivity
Chapter 7: Target Fluctuation Models
Chapter 8: Doppler Phenomenology and Data Acquisition
Part III: Subsystems
Chapter 9: Radar Antennas
Chapter 10: Radar Transmitters
Chapter 11: Radar Receivers
Chapter 12: Radar Exciters
Chapter 13: The Radar Signal Processor
Part IV: Signal and Data Processing
Chapter 14: Digital Signal Processing Fundamentals for Radar
Chapter 15: Threshold Detection of Radar Targets
Chapter 16: Constant False Alarm Rate Detectors
Chapter 17: Doppler Processing
Chapter 18: Radar Measurements
Chapter 19: Radar Tracking Algorithms
Chapter 20: Fundamentals of Pulse Compression Waveforms
Chapter 21: An Overview of Radar Imaging
Appendix A: Maxwell's Equations and Decibel Notation
Appendix B: Answers to Selected Problems
